There were three main phases in the study, namely pre-design survey, material development, and also post-design survey which were aimed to ease the
research conduct process. In pre-design survey, first and second step of R D, namely research and information collecting and planning were used. Information
needed were gained through questionnaire distributed to the students and interview conducted to the English teacher. The data gathered will be used to plan
and design the material. After conducting the first phase, it will be followed by developing the material. In this phase, the third up to fifth step of R D were
implemented. The phase was started with designing the material and after that the material were tested to gain feedback from experts and users. The revised material
then will be distributed to the students to look for their opinions and suggestions
49
from the students as the users. The results of the questionnaire distributed to the students along with the material will be used for final revision.
B. RESEARCH DESIGN
There are four topics that would be discussed under research design, namely research participants, research instruments, data gathering technique, and data
analysis technique. Research participants consisted of three participants; those were the students, the teachers and the experts in language teaching and also
information and technology. The research instruments used in the study were questionnaire, interview, and classroom observation. Moreover, this sub chapter
will also explain more about data gathering technique and data analysis technique.
1. Research Participants
There were three types of research participants for this study. The first one was Junior High School students. Seventh grade students of SMP Maria
Immaculata Yogyakarta were selected as the participants since the material are designed for them. The writer distributed the questionnaire for the needs analysis
to one class consisting twenty six students. Moreover, for gaining data for users’
feedback, the questionnaire was distributed to the same class. In addition, on the effort of collecting feedbacks from the students, the number of participants was
twenty four. Two students were reported couldn’t come to school at that day for
personal and medical reason. The second one was English teachers. There are two English teachers who
teach seven graders. They were the respondents for needs analysis and for the post
50
design survey phase. For needs analysis, the writer conducted an interview with the English teacher teaching the classes where the questionnaire was distributed.
While for post design survey, both English teachers were involved. Their feedback and suggestions will be needed to improve the material. The third one
was experts. Experts here refer to English lecturers and media experts. They were the participants in the post-design survey phase. Their feedback and suggestions
were needed to improve the material along with the feedback and suggestions from the English teachers.
2. Research Instruments
There were three instruments used in the study. Those were a set of questionnaire, interview and observation checklist. Questionnaire is used in all
phases. Moreover, interview and observation are only used in pre-design survey to gather data from the English teachers.
a. Questionnaire
There are some definitions of questionnaire used in the study. According to Wallace 1998, questionnaire is an instrument to gather information needed
through the part icipants’ written response to a list of questions. Added by Johnson
and Christensen 2012 that questionnaire is a kind of self-report instrument that should be filled by the respondents as the part of the research being conducted. It
could be used for collecting quantitative data, qualitative data and mixed data. There are two form of questionnaire that is closed and open form. In the open
form, respondents could only select the best response to the questions based on the choices provided, while in the open form, respondents could write down their
51
response without any border. In the study, questionnaire was used to gather quantitative data and also qualitative data. Moreover, the form of questionnaire
being used in the study was both closed and open form questionnaire. In forming the questionnaire to be distributed to the students, a closed form
questionnaire was used. Options were provided and they just needed to select the best option. There was no open-ended question in this phase. The data gained
from the questionnaire then analyzed to look for the average distribution of certain item. For the questionnaire for the teachers, open form questionnaire was selected.
It was aimed to gain feedback and suggestions from the English teachers, and experts. The data gained then were analyzed and converted into scale to get the
